Output 5192d965ffa2332457b1bf76acfeabf21ce7f1e95c208e80d8edae9633608b96:0

value
506806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c135843ba4b13bdb784bdf8c7f41ec5eea9ff02 OP_EQUAL
address
34FU21mmBmmjZMbApGrtBxE2PRpJSyqZJy
transaction
5192d965ffa2332457b1bf76acfeabf21ce7f1e95c208e80d8edae9633608b96
spent
true